我只是想在现有的表中添加一个新列。这是我的迁移:
use Illuminate\Support\Facades\Schema;
use Illuminate\Database\Schema\Blueprint;
use Illuminate\Database\Migrations\Migration;
class AddWarehouse extends Migration
{
/**
* Run the migrations.
*
* @return void
*/
public function up()
{
我是GraphQL和灯塔的新手。
我从得到的理解是,对于嵌套的GraphQL查询,“在幕后,灯塔将在一个数据库查询中对关系查询进行批处理。”
但是,我在日志中看到了所有这些查询,其中应该只有1:
select count(*) as aggregate from `posts`
select * from `posts` order by `created_at` asc limit 20 offset 0
select * from `post_files` where `post_files`.`post_id` in (249, 5...
select * from `post_tags
我正在将L5.1.x中现有的projekt迁移到运行server 2012和SQL Server 2012的新服务器上。
在为表使用时间戳()字段时,我遇到了一些问题。当我加入我的计划时:
$table->timestamps();
我将得到类型为"datetime“的created_at和updated_at列。
但是对于新的配置,当我尝试向这个数据库添加一个模型时,我总是会收到这样的错误:
QueryException: Unable to convert an nvarchar Value to and datetime Value ....
当我禁用Model中的时间戳字
运行时出现错误(在laravel中)
php artisan migrate --seed
我得到了
Object of class DateTime could not be converted to string
我的用户种子表如下所示
class UsersTableSeeder extends Seeder
{
public function run()
{
DB::table('users')->delete();
$users = [
[
'fir
有点复杂和混乱..。但是我有一个叫做建筑的模型,这个模型和同一个模型有关系,但是有一个belongsToMany关系.
在这个模型中,我有以下关系:
# Building Require one or more another Building(s)
public function requires() {
return $this->belongsToMany('Building', 'building_require')->withPivot(array(
'level',
我已经创建了一个包含两个表的数据库,"goals“和"partgoals”。实际用途是制定一个储蓄目标(金钱),并在此过程中建立里程碑(部分目标)。我希望部分目标明显地与特定的目标相关联。关系已创建,但我在尝试创建种子数据时遇到了麻烦。
我的目标是建立两个这样的目标表(GoalsTableSeeder.php):
<?php
class GoalsTableSeeder extends Seeder {
public function run()
{
DB::table('goals')->delete();
我有一个用户访问表,我想执行一个查询,返回按日期访问的次数。
我的表中有以下各列:
id
type -> int
id_user -> int
created_at -> datetime
我的数据库记录:
我正在尝试这个查询:
$admin = userAccess::distinct()
->select(DB::raw('count(*) as total ') , DB::raw('DATE_FORMAT(created_at, "%Y-%m-%d")'), DB:
我正在用Laravel4创建消息系统,我很困惑如何以这种方式从mysql中检索数据。
对于数据库中没有3个表的情况:
conversations:
id int A_I PRIMARY
subject varchar 128
created_at datetime
updated_at datetime
conversations_messages:
id int A_I PRIMARY
conversa
我正在尝试导出包含多个工作簿的工作表,并从一个视图生成每个工作簿。我已经创建了5个包含超文本标记语言表格的不同.blade文件,并希望从每个.blade文件生成每个工作簿。
我正在尝试导出包含多个工作簿的工作表,并从一个视图生成每个工作簿。我已经创建了5个包含超文本标记语言表格的不同.blade文件,并希望从每个.blade文件生成每个工作簿。
<?php
namespace App\Exports;
use App\Models\GenerateQrCode;
use App\Models\Scan;
use DateInterval;
use DatePeriod;
use Dat
我想添加我的用户的created_at列的精确性。因此,我创建了另一个迁移文件来更新created_at的属性,但是它不起作用。
这是我的迁移文件
/**
* Run the migrations.
*
* @return void
*/
public function up()
{
Schema::table('users', function (Blueprint $table) {
$table->dateTime('created_at', 3)->change();
});
}
/**
* Re
user_enabled_notifications表有2行数据。我想获取id列中的所有值。
$notificationData = UserEnabledNotifications::all();
dump($notificationData['id']);显示Undefined index: id
dump($notificationData->id);显示Property [id] does not exist on this collection instance
dump($notificationData[0]['id']);只显示一个id。我